Beautiful finger coverage. I have a 1/2 eternity from IDJ that are 5 pts each. The spinning does bother me so I wish I had done a full eternity band.

Sometimes the stones / prongs bother me when it rubs against my fingers.

How do you rate yours as far as comfort? Does it sit low? When you squeeze your fingers , does it bother you?

I would say the band is pretty comfortable. I regret getting it .25 bigger than my actual ring size. I swell often, and thought it would be ok, but no, it was just unnecessary wiggle room for spinning.
The stones and prongs don't bother me though, feels a lot like any other ring and I actually can't feel the prongs at all.

In terms of appearance, I definitely prefer a full eternity band for the all around coverage. I have the tendency to slam my hand against things harder than I should, and I'm quite clumsy. So I felt it might be safer for me to do 8 stones. I think if I were to re-do this, I would go 9 stones and with a smaller ring size.
